Agents Remarks

This stunning 1950's period home stands in a highly regarded residential location within a select range of premium housing. The house has been comprehensively extended improved and enhanced to provide a sensational blend of original period character and chic design with contemporary features. The property exudes exceptional character and appeal with fixtures and fittings of the highest calibre and stands within wonderful landscaped gardens and surroundings. The house is located on the periphery of Shavington village, nearby to facilities, well regarded schooling and within easy access to A500.

Property Details

A handsome pair of wrought iron gates stand within high brick pillared gateways providing access over a splayed herringbone block paved driveway that leads to a further parking area. An impressive oak tiled pitched porch stands to the front of the property and a high quality composite door within surround leads to:

Glorious Reception Hall

A most impressive entrance to the property with an oak and glazed staircase ascending to first floor galleried landing, original herringbone wood block flooring, oak door to under stairs cupboard, recessed ceiling lighting and an oak door leads to:

Lounge

17' 10'' x 12' 10'' (5.43m x 3.92m)

A delightful reception room with a uPVC double glazed bow window to front elevation incorporating fitted shutters, large Cheshire brick fireplace with Inglenook inset incorporating a log burning stove upon herringbone Cheshire brick laid hearth, mantel over and television niche and herringbone wood block flooring,

From the Reception Hall a sectional glazed oak door leads to:

Stunning Open Plan Living Family Dining Kitchen

21' 1'' x 21' 0'' (6.43m x 6.40m)

A simply superb space with outstanding aspects over the rear gardens via five panel bi-folding doors.

Impeccably appointed with a lovely range of high quality shaker style base and wall mounted units, attractive marble working surfaces and upstands, four ring NEFF hob, powder blue AGA inset within chimney breast with oak mantel over, large central dining island incorporating twin enamel Belfast sinks with SMEG mixer tap and cupboards and drawers beneath, integrated dishwasher, pull out pantry drawer unit with niche for American fridge freezer, oak flooring, exposed feature Cheshire brick walling incorporating television niche, contemporary freestanding log, burning stove upon slate plinth, recessed ceiling, uPVC double glazed window to side elevation and a sectional oak glazed door leads to:

Laundry/Utility Room

With high quality shaker style base and wall mounted units, attractive marble working surface, plumbing for washing machine, space for tumble drier, underslung sink with mixer tap, uPVC double glazed window, oak flooring, recessed ceiling lighting and a panel door leads to:

Cloakroom

With WC, contemporary radiator and uPVC double glazed window.

From the Utility Room an oak door leads to:

Dining/Sitting Room

11' 1'' x 12' 10'' (3.37m x 3.90m)

With uPVC double glazed doors to rear gardens, recessed ceiling lighting, contemporary radiator and oak flooring.

From the Utility Room a doorway leads to:

Integral Garage

19' 0'' x 13' 0'' (5.80m x 3.95m)

A spacious garage with a remote controlled roller door and a large capacity central heating boiler.

First Floor Galleried Landing

A most impressive and spacious landing with recessed ceiling lighting, uPVC double glazed window to front elevation incorporating fitted shutters, oak door to deep walk-in airing cupboard, contemporary radiator, access to loft and an oak door leads to:

Master Bedroom Suite

Bedroom

21' 2'' x 12' 10'' (6.46m x 3.90m)

An outstanding principal bedroom with partially vaulted ceiling incorporating a chimney Velux window, full height uPVC double glazed windows and double doors incorporating fitted blinds leading to glazed balcony overlooking rear gardens, ceiling beam, limed engineered oak flooring, recessed ceiling lighting, column radiator and an oak door leads to:

Dressing Room

With a superb range of full height and width fitted wardrobes, limed engineered oak flooring, recessed ceiling lighting and an oak door leads to:

Contemporary En-Suite Bathroom

With a freestanding claw and ball roll top bath with antique shower tap stand to side, double glazed window incorporating fitted shutters, twin vanity wash basin with cupboards beneath, WC, large walk-in shower tray with full height screen, fully tiled walls tiled flooring, recessed ceiling lighting and antique style towel radiator.

Bedroom Two

14' 4'' x 12' 10'' (4.38m x 3.92m)

A spacious room with a uPVC double glazed window to side elevation and contemporary radiator.

Bedroom Three

11' 7'' x 12' 10'' (3.54m x 3.92m)

With a uPVC double glazed window to front elevation incorporating fitted shutters and contemporary radiator

Bedroom Four

11' 1'' x 12' 10'' (3.38m x 3.90m)

With a uPVC double glazed window to rear elevation incorporating fitted shutters affording beautiful aspects, shelving niche, oak flooring and contemporary radiator.

Family Bathroom

With freestanding bath incorporating central shower tap stand, large walk-in shower tray with full height glazed screen, WC, pedestal wash basin upon stand, attractive tiled flooring, part tiled walls, recessed ceiling lighting, contemporary towel radiator and uPVC double glazed window.

Externally

Beautiful rear gardens with lovely aspects in the periphery and benefiting from an extensive lawned garden area, an abundance of mature plants, trees and shrubs, a curved paved pathway and a large patio area. The gardens are bordered and screened by high mature trees and fencing.
